Output db8ff842ac51a1cef3838c2cc369b391505bfb4f19dc17609ac25a07dbdb06b3:1

value
59731361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5ebca59bb8d7e5e844621280eea8d79554a57f OP_EQUAL
address
3JgT6fD1cXjqKJQgYcvnCrUafFvsSbf5t4
transaction
db8ff842ac51a1cef3838c2cc369b391505bfb4f19dc17609ac25a07dbdb06b3
confirmations
251047
spent
true